China Southern To Launch New Shanghai-Beijing-Amsterdam Service On June 28;
Airline Expanding European Service, Paris-Guangzhou To Begin In Late June

GUANGZHOU, China - June 1, 2004 - China Southern Airlines (NYSE: ZNH) (HKSE: 1055), www.csair.com/en, the largest airline in The People¡¯s Republic of China is pleased to announce that it will be launching new service from Shanghai to Amsterdam via Beijing.

The new Boeing 777 Shanghai-Beijing-Amsterdam service - slated to begin June 28 - is timed to begin on the official opening day of the new Baiyun International Airport in Guangzhou ¡­ and will be operated under a code-share agreement with KLM Royal Dutch Airlines, www.klm.com.

China Southern¡¯s new Shanghai (Pudong) - Beijing - Amsterdam roundtrip service, will be available every Monday, Thursday and Sunday (China Southern flight numbers CZ343/344), departing from Shanghai¡¯s Pudong International Airport at 10:00 a.m. and arriving at Beijing at 11:55 a.m., then continuing on to Amsterdam at 13:20 and arriving at Schiphol Airport Amsterdam at 17:50 (local time).

China Southern¡¯s new Shanghai-Beijing-Amsterdam service compliments the airline¡¯s current Guangzhou-Beijing-Amsterdam service (China Southern flight numbers CZ345/346) every Tuesday and Friday.

¡°All told, our new Shanghai-Beijing-Amsterdam and current Guangzhou-Beijing-Amsterdam service expands China Southern¡¯s service to Amsterdam to five flights per week from mainland China to the heart of Europe ¡­ and is perfectly timed for the launch of the peak summer holiday season,¡± said Mr. Li.

China Southern Airlines will also be launching its new four weekly direct non-stop Guangzhou-Paris service on June 28,
